Xperia Z3 Speakers

Multimedia experience is one of the factors that any user would look for in a smart phone and looking at the likes of HTC, smart phone manufacturers need to pickup up the momentum and bring something powerful to the table. Sony’s Xperia Z2 offers best multimedia experience comparing to like of Galaxy S5, iPhone 5S and other smart phone manufacturers expect HTC. The front firing hidden speakers on the Xperia Z2 offers good overall sound, but it lacks the depth, the bass when compared to the front firing speakers on the HTC. Sony has added some sound setting to the Xperia Z2, but it doesn’t catchup to the like f HTC again. Xperia Z3 on other hand will have the same speaker setup with 50% more output offering premium class sound. But till an official announcement or launch we can only hope that it will be better than any other smart phones. What Sony lacks in speaker quality, it catches up in headphones where Sony’s flagship still lags behind HTC but better than any other smart phones with their headphones.

Xperia Z3 Camera

Now, we come to one of the most interesting hardware in smartphones these days, the camera. Xperia Z2 made it to the headline for the best camera and rated number 1 by DXOMARK but recently beat by Galaxy S5. Xperia Z2’s camera is one the best offering best performance in literally any lighting conditions. Considering the likes of HTC M8 which overexposes with dim lighting, the Xperia Z2 gave perfectly exposed images with perfect color balance and saturation and ofcourse with some noise here and there. However this story is going to change with the advent of Xperia Z3 which is going to offer a 24 Megapixel camera with 1/2” sensor giving you perfectly saturated, exposed pic in almost any lighting conditions. But the fact that Xperia Z3 has a smaller sensor means that noise can creep in with poor lighting conditions. The 24 megapixel shooter will be the perfect blend but the fact that Xperia Z2’s 21 MP camera was beaten by a 16MP shooter on the Galaxy S5 makes us think the Note 4 with it’s 16MP shooter may have it beat.
